A blockchain is a distributed computing architecture where every network node executes and records the same transactions, which are grouped into blocks. The intent of the fee system is to require an attacker to pay proportionately for every resource that they consume, including computation, bandwidth and storage; hence, any transaction that leads to the network consuming a greater amount of any of these resources must have a gas fee roughly proportional to the increment. The main difference between Ethereum and Bitcoin with regard to the blockchain architecture is that, unlike Bitcoin which only contains a copy of the transaction list , Ethereum blocks contain a copy of both the transaction list and the most recent state.
